Digital assets are highly volatile and speculative, making them an important consideration in investment planning. Any client considering a crypto allocation should understand that the value of these assets can fluctuate sharply, potentially leading to significant losses, including the risk of losing principal. Before investing, we will help you navigate the specific risks involved, which are crucial for a comprehensive wealth strategy, including:
Market & Volatility Risk: Crypto prices may rise or fall rapidly and are influenced by various factors such as market sentiment, liquidity conditions, leverage, regulatory developments, and technological changes.
Custody & Platform Risk: Digital assets may be stored with third-party custodians, exchanges, or platforms that could encounter operational failures, cybersecurity incidents, insolvency, fraud, or restricted access.
Regulatory & Legal Risk: The legal and regulatory environment surrounding digital assets is continually evolving, impacting their availability, transferability, reporting requirements, and the overall economics of ownership.
Technology & Liquidity Risk: Vulnerabilities within blockchain networks and smart contracts can lead to congestion or other technological disruptions. Additionally, some digital assets may experience periods of reduced liquidity or limited market access.
